Mike H
I am using Creator 9 with a Dazzle. I am trying to capture either to disc or plug&play burn. I both tools I can see the picture and hear audio, but the status message is "No signal" and the Capture Now button is unavailable. The kicker is that this used to work; I have done this many times, though I have not done it in over a year. In that time, I have made no hardware changes.

To summarize, I have a VCR with RCA connectors into a dazzle. I Video Plug & Burn, the Input = Composite Video. Options Device = Dazzle DVC90. I have a DVD-R in the drive and ready to go. I can see the picture playing in the preview, and I am hearing audio.

Windows XP

Any thoughts?

tbrewst
Plug and Burn won't work.That's for importing from a digital video camera.
You need to use Media Import.The Device should be the Dazzle,the input should be Composite.
You should see the picture if it's set correctly.You should also hear sound,if you don't then go to options below the picture and make sure the sound is not muted.
If all this happens then you should be able to capture.Make sure you start the tape and have a picture before you hit Capture.

I've done this many times and it works with no problems.
